#b39634 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b39634 is composed of 70.2% red, 58.8%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 16.2% magenta, 70.9%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 46.3 degrees, a saturation of 55% and a lightness of 45.3%. #b39634 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ff68 with #672d00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

#b39634 color description : Moderate yellow.

#b39634 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#b39634 has RGB values of R:179, G:150, B:52 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.16, Y:0.71,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 11769396.

Shades and Tints of #b39634

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0a03 is the darkest color, while #fefd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#b39634

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#757472 is the less saturated color, while #dfae08 is the most saturated one.
